Don't know much about Lubin's game that hasn't been said but he plays with the AAU program Atlanta Celtics, a lot of good players came through there. Think he transferred from a high school in AL to one in GA. A lot of talent in the area to recruit... Also, not concrete on this but I believe Dion Glover was/is the AAU coach, former NBA player who played against Ollie.

Most people are addressing this from the perspective of kids who made the NBA. I'll take a different approach.

Do we win the championship without Chuck? Probably not.
Do we win the championship without Wane? Probably not.

So there's a chance he's an Armstrong like player who develops into a significant factor and an NBA player. But if he 'only' develops into a solid role player like Chuck or Wane who gives that additional 3 or 4 points to get your over the top, that's something you need to win championships.

Just stop with the he's not good enough BS. You don't know what he is. I don't know what he is. Ollie has watched him and has a slightly better idea.

And yes, I still want to land a couple 4 star or better players - but there's nothing wrong with 4 year lunch pail kids who work hard, get an education and help the team be 3 or 4 points better.
